Day Trips to Fiskardo and Assos
No trip to Kefalonia is complete without exploring the picturesque villages of Fiskardo and Assos. These charming destinations, located on the island’s north-west coast, are filled with character, history, and stunning scenery.
1. Fiskardo: A Historic Yachting Village
Fiskardo is one of the few towns on Kefalonia that remained intact after the 1953 earthquake, preserving its colourful Venetian buildings. Stroll along the waterfront lined with yachts, explore boutique shops, and enjoy local delicacies at quaint cafes and tavernas. Don’t miss a visit to the iconic Fiskardo Lighthouse and the nearby Emblisi Beach for its crystal-clear waters.
2. Assos: A Village with a View
Assos is a tranquil village surrounded by lush greenery and turquoise waters. Take a leisurely walk through its narrow streets, and climb to the historic Assos Castle for panoramic views. End your day with a meal at a waterfront taverna as the sun sets over the bay.
